24-819. Judges; full term; commencement; end.

The full term of office of each judge shall commence: (1) On the first Thursday after the first Tuesday in January next succeeding the election referred to in sections 24-813 to 24-818, or (2) if appointed pursuant to Article V of the Constitution of Nebraska, on the date of his or her appointment, as the case may be. For purposes of sections 24-817 and 24-818, the end of the term of office shall be the first Thursday after the first Tuesday in January next succeeding the retention election required by section 24-814.

Source

  • Laws 1969, c. 178, § 8, p. 768;
  • Laws 2009, LB343, § 1.

Annotations

  • Action of Legislature in adopting this section simply declaratory of Constitution. Garrotto v. McManus, 185 Neb. 644, 177 N.W.2d 570 (1970).
